Bug 463617

Summary: unwanted disclosure of directory names (privacy issue)
Product: [Applications] dolphin Reporter: Ulrich Deiters <ulrich.deiters>
Component: bars: locationAssignee: Dolphin Bug Assignee <dolphin-bugs-null>
Status: RESOLVED FIXED    
Severity: wishlist CC: felixernst, kfm-devel, ulrich.deiters
Priority: NOR    
Version: 21.12.3   
Target Milestone: ---   
Platform: openSUSE   
OS: Linux   
Latest Commit: Version Fixed In:
Sentry Crash Report:

Description Ulrich Deiters 2022-12-30 12:41:12 UTC
When a Dolphin instance is opened, the menu bar shows the symbol "personal folder", followed by the actual folder path (/ > home > my_name > …). A click on the "personal folder" symbol shows a menu containing a long list of the folders and devices that used during the previous months.

I do not want Dolphin to memorize all my movements. Can I purge the list? Or better: Can I set up Dolphin in such a way that the menu shows *only* the personal folder, the root folder, and eventually the mount points of mounted file systems.


STEPS TO REPRODUCE
1. Open a Dolphin instance with a menu bar containing an address field
2. Click on the "personal folder" symbol
3. 

OBSERVED RESULT
A drop-down menu opend that shows the previously visited folders.


EXPECTED RESULT
… should merely show the persola folder, the root folder, and eventually mounted file systems

SOFTWARE/OS VERSIONS
Windows: 
macOS: 
Linux/KDE Plasma:  openSUSE Leap 15.4
(available in About System)
KDE Plasma Version: 
KDE Frameworks Version: 
Qt Version: 

ADDITIONAL INFORMATION
Comment 1 Felix Ernst 2022-12-30 13:51:37 UTC
>When a Dolphin instance is opened, the menu bar shows the symbol "personal folder",
>followed by the actual folder path (/ > home > my_name > …). A click on the "personal folder"
>symbol shows a menu containing a long list of the folders and devices that used during the previous months.

I am not totally sure if I understand which button you mean, so excuse me if my response will be wrong.

I assume you are talking about the button that is only visible when the "Places" panel is hidden. The "Places" panel can be shown/hidden by pressing the F9 key. This button is a replacement for the places panel and therefore contains similar actions as the "Places" panel. You can first show that panel again and then edit the contents of that panel using right-click menus. Once you hide the panel again, the button you are talking about should reflect the changes you did to the places panel.

>Or better: Can I set up Dolphin in such a way that the menu shows *only* the personal folder,
>the root folder, and eventually the mount points of mounted file systems.

You can hide sections in the places panel and this will also hide them in the menu of that button.

>I do not want Dolphin to memorize all my movements. Can I purge the list?

Recently accessed files can be purged under system settings>recent files. There you can also disable the feature of keeping track of your recent files.

I hope this solves all your problems!
Comment 2 Ulrich Deiters 2022-12-30 17:05:25 UTC
Greetings,

and thank you for the fast reply! I was indeed referring
to what is called "Places" menu in English. With you help
I was able to purge the list of "places" manually.

> Recently accessed files can be purged under system settings>recent files. There
> you can also disable the feature of keeping track of your recent files.

"system settings" of which program? The Dolphin configuration
menu does not have a "system settings" menu. Perhaps I am
confused because I am using Dolphin with German language setting,
but I cannot recognize any menu points that deal with file tracking.

Regards,

Ulrich Deiters
Comment 3 Felix Ernst 2022-12-30 17:14:50 UTC
Well, I guess I'll switch to German then. :^)

>"system settings" of which program?

Ich rede von den Systemeinstellungen. Die zuletzt verwendeten Daten werden nicht von Dolphin direkt verwaltet, sondern zentral für alle Anwendungen durch die Anwendung "Systemeinstellungen", die bei KDE Plasma in der Regel mitgeliefert wird.

Falls Sie Dolphin außerhalb der Desktopumgebung KDE Plasma verwenden, dann ist bei Ihnen das Program "Systemeinstellungen", dass zu KDE Plasma gehört, vermutlich gar nicht installiert. Aber grundsätzlich müssten auch andere Desktopumgebungen eine Möglichkeit anbieten, die zuletzt verwendeten Dateien zu verwalten. Wie es genau bei anderen läuft, weiß ich aber nicht so genau. Ich weiß, dass die KDEs Systemeinstellungen auch die zuletzt verwendeten Dateien von Gnome verwalten können sollen, jedoch ist mir nicht bekannt, ob Gnomes Systemeinstellungen auch den Anspruch haben, zuletzt verwendete Dateien von KDE Anwendungen verwalten zu können.
Comment 4 Ulrich Deiters 2022-12-30 18:24:03 UTC
Am 30.12.22 um 18:14 schrieb Felix Ernst:
> Well, I guess I'll switch to German then. :^)

Das ist besser!
  :-)

>> "system settings" of which program?
> Ich rede von den Systemeinstellungen. Die zuletzt verwendeten Daten werden
> nicht von Dolphin direkt verwaltet, sondern zentral für alle Anwendungen durch
> die Anwendung "Systemeinstellungen", die bei KDE Plasma in der Regel
> mitgeliefert wird.

Ich verwende KDE, und „Systemeinstellungen“ sind installiert. Aber wo
müsste ich denn da suchen? „Starten und Beenden/Hintergrunddienste“
kommt dem, was ich such wohl am nächsten, aber da finde ich nichts
Passendes.

Viele Grüße

Ulrich Deiters
Comment 5 Felix Ernst 2022-12-31 11:04:51 UTC
>Ich verwende KDE, und „Systemeinstellungen“ sind installiert. Aber wo
>müsste ich denn da suchen? „Starten und Beenden/Hintergrunddienste“
>kommt dem, was ich such wohl am nächsten, aber da finde ich nichts
>Passendes.

Bei mir ist es unter "Verhalten des Arbeitsbereichs>Zuletzt verwendete Dateien",
aber ich sehe gerade, dass das erst neulich an diese Stelle geschoben wurde.
Davor war es schwerer zu finden – nämlich unter "Verhalten des Arbeitsbereichs>Aktivitäten>Privatsphäre".
Bei Ihnen ist es wohl auch noch dort.

Hier ist der Bug Report, der darüber geht, wie schwer es zu finden ist ^^: https://bugs.kde.org/show_bug.cgi?id=416271

Grüße!
Comment 6 Ulrich Deiters 2022-12-31 12:27:25 UTC
Am 31.12.22 um 12:04 schrieb Felix Ernst:
> Bei Ihnen ist es wohl auch noch dort.

Stimmt! Da hatte ich es wirklich nicht gesucht – zumal
ich bis heute nicht ganz verstanden habe, was eine
„Aktivität“ sein soll.

Viele Dank für Ihre Hilfe!
Ich wünsche Ihnen ein gutes neues Jahr.

Ulrich Deiters
Comment 7 Felix Ernst 2022-12-31 16:13:03 UTC
>Ich wünsche Ihnen ein gutes neues Jahr.

Ihnen auch!